Welcome to the Ledgerline dedupe service. Customer records from Harbrook imports are matched on normalized name and postal fields, then merged under a survivorship policy reviewed quarterly. All merge batches are signed before they enter the reconciliation queue, so auditors can verify provenance. The signing key used by the batch runner is shown below.

deploy key for kajof-fajop: bky6_gDHw9Q

Attendees: division heads and finance liaison. The committee reviewed next year's headcount proposal in detail. Agreed: net growth of fourteen roles, weighted toward the Greymoor fulfilment centre and the data platform group. Attrition assumptions were revised to 9% following finance's challenge. All requisitions will route through the quarterly gating process, with finance holding veto on off-cycle hires. A revised workbook circulates Friday. The underlying business rationale, approved by the steering group, is recorded below.

internal memo for kawip-hadug: Headcount on the Wenwyn team goes from 7 to 140 by the end of January. Gross margin on Wenwyn came in at 20 percent against a plan of 15 percent.

After deploying the Verdansa greenhouse controller, sensor drift compensation must be re-armed or humidity readings will skew within hours. Run the calibration job once per bay and confirm each probe reports a delta under 0.4 before proceeding — support has seen cases where a skipped bay caused vents to cycle all night. Once calibration passes, the controller needs to push corrected readings to the telemetry hub, which requires an upload credential. Place that credential in the controller's .env file on the line that follows.

secret setting of bajeg-yahog: LEDGER_TOKEN20=f833f3e2e6625ec0dee3

## Ownership

The clock-skew monitor for the Quarrylight build farm lives in this repo. Build agents occasionally drift more than the 250ms tolerance, which breaks artifact timestamp ordering and causes the Slatebird scheduler to mark runs as flaky. If support sees skew alerts, first check the NTP sidecar logs, then escalate rather than restarting agents manually — restarts mask the drift without fixing it. Questions about the monitor, its thresholds, or the escalation path go to the component owner listed below.

account owner for kagag-yahap: Novath Quenok